What are the key cold chain logistics updates and technologies in 2025?

Automation, IoT and AI are at the heart of cold chain logistics updates in 2025. Companies are adopting automated storage and retrieval systems, robotic handling and machine‑learning tools to cut labour costs, improve accuracy and keep products within safe temperature rangestrackonomy.ai. IoT sensors and tracking devices provide real‑time visibility into temperature, humidité et emplacementarcadiacold.com, enabling you to detect problems before they cause spoilage. Artificial intelligence crunches this data to optimise routes, forecast demand and perform predictive maintenancetrackonomy.ai. With these technologies, businesses improve efficiency and reduce waste while meeting stricter regulations and consumer expectations.

Explication élargie

Technological adoption is increasing because traditional cold chain infrastructure is ageing and labour costs are rising. À propos 80 % of warehouses are still not automatedtrackonomy.ai, so the potential efficiency gains are huge. Automated systems operate continuously, minimise human error and help maintain precise temperature and humidity levelstrackonomy.ai. Sustainability pressures are also pushing companies to invest in energy‑efficient refrigeration, renewable energy and eco‑friendly packagingtrackonomy.ai. Real‑time tracking and IoT monitoring not only optimise delivery routes but also create verifiable records to meet regulatory audits and improve customer satisfactiontrackonomy.ai. AI‑based tools analyse historical and real‑time data, predict disruptions (such as traffic or weather) and recommend alternative routestrackonomy.ai. These technologies together build resilient and transparent supply chains, which will be essential as demand for temperature‑sensitive products grows.

How are market dynamics shaping cold chain logistics in 2025?

Le 2025 cold chain logistics market is expanding quickly and diversifying across regions and sectors. The global market size is USD 436.3 milliard dans 2025 and is forecast to reach USD 1.36 trillion par 2034 à un 13.46 % TCACprecedenceresearch.com. The Asia‑Pacific region will grow fastest at around 14.3 % annuellementprecedenceresearch.com, while North America’s food cold chain market will reach USD 86.67 milliard par 2025trackonomy.ai. Demand is rising because of population growth, higher incomes, plant‑based foods, biologics and e‑commerce. A growing portion of new pharmaceuticals — about 20 % — are gene and cell‑based therapies requiring strict temperature controltrackonomy.ai. Pre‑cooling facilities (valorisé à USD 204.4 milliard dans 2024) and refrigerated warehouses (USD 238.29 milliard) are receiving heavy investmentprecedenceresearch.com.

Explication élargie

These figures highlight how cold chain logistics is moving from a niche service to a critical infrastructure for global trade. Population growth and rising incomes in Asia and Latin America are increasing demand for fresh and frozen foods. Pendant la pandémie, supply chains pivoted to direct‑to‑consumer deliveries; this model continues, with meal kits and online grocery orders creating demand for last‑mile cold storagearcadiacold.com. Entre-temps, the pharmaceutical sector’s rapid innovation (Par exemple, mRNA vaccines and gene therapies) requires ultra‑cold storage and precise temperature monitoringtrackonomy.ai. Investments in new foods, tel que plant‑based proteins, are also driving refrigerated transportmaersk.com. The packaging market alone will grow from USD 30.88 milliard dans 2025 à USD 64.49 milliard par 2032 avec un 11.09 % TCACnatlawreview.com.

Why does sustainability and regulation matter in modern cold chains?

Sustainability is not optional in 2025; it reduces costs, meets regulations and supports environmental goals. Cold chain logistics consumes a lot of energy and is responsible for roughly 2 % des émissions mondiales de CO₂trackonomy.ai. Regulations in food and pharmaceuticals now require more rigorous standards like BRC and SQF certifications to ensure safety and traceabilityarcadiacold.com. To comply and remain competitive, companies are upgrading infrastructure, adopting renewable energy and using eco‑friendly materials. Solar‑powered cold storage units reduce energy costs—commercial solar rates in 2024 ranged from 3.2–15.5 cents/kWh versus average utility rates of 13.10 cents/kWhpharmanow.live. Moving frozen storage from –18 °C to –15 °C is also being considered to cut energy usearcadiacold.com.

Explication élargie

Environmental regulations and consumer expectations are driving companies to lower their carbon footprint. Energy‑efficient refrigeration, high‑performance insulation and solar‑powered cold storage are becoming mainstream, especially in regions with unreliable power gridspharmanow.live. Sustainable packaging — such as recyclable insulated containers, biodegradable wraps and reusable cold packs — reduces waste and appeals to eco‑conscious customerspharmanow.live. Regulations like Saudi Arabia’s SASO Technical Regulations and the UAE’s Net Zero 2050 strategy require cold chain operators to meet strict environmental and quality standardsmaersk.com. En plus, retailers are migrating from older AIB/ASI certifications to stringent BRC and SQF standardsarcadiacold.com, meaning warehouses must upgrade to advanced temperature control and tracking technologies. These improvements not only reduce emissions but also decrease operating costs through energy savings.

What innovations are driving pharmaceutical and food cold chains?

Chaîne de blocs, capteurs intelligents, AI‑powered route optimisation and portable cryogenic freezers are transforming cold chains for pharmaceuticals and food. Blockchain creates tamper‑proof records of each shipment, improving traceability and reducing customs clearance timesmaersk.com. IoT sensors send real‑time alerts when temperature or humidity deviates, helping prevent product damagepharmanow.live. AI‑powered route optimisation combines traffic and weather data to generate efficient delivery routespharmanow.live. Portable cryogenic freezers maintain ultra‑cold temperatures (–80 °C à –150 °C) for biologics and cell therapiespharmanow.live. These innovations ensure safety, reduce waste and support new therapies and foods.

Explication élargie

The pharmaceutical industry’s cold chain requirements are stricter than ever because of vaccines, gene and cell therapies and biologics. Chaîne de blocs ensures data integrity by linking shipment information in an immutable chainmaersk.com. This technology speeds up regulatory audits and builds trust among partners. Solar‑powered cold storage units address inconsistent electricity supplies in rural areas while lowering operating costspharmanow.live. IoT‑enabled sensors monitor temperature, humidité et emplacement; when readings fall outside safe ranges they automatically alert operatorspharmanow.live. AI‑powered route optimisation uses real‑time traffic and weather analysis to shorten transit times and reduce risk of spoilagepharmanow.live. Congélateurs cryogéniques portables provide mobile ultra‑cold storage for cell and gene therapies, with real‑time temperature trackingpharmanow.live. Dernièrement, emballage durable reduces environmental impact while preserving product integritypharmanow.live.

How do regional trends and strategic partnerships impact cold chain logistics?

Regional innovation and collaboration determine how effectively cold chain logistics updates are implemented. Dans le Moyen-Orient, investments in IoT, AI and blockchain provide real‑time visibility and predictive intelligence, helping handle extreme heat and high energy costsmaersk.com. AI forecasts consumption patterns and optimises routes during seasonal spikes like Ramadanmaersk.com, while blockchain reduces fraud and accelerates customs clearancemaersk.com. Strategic partnerships — among food producers, packaging suppliers and technology providers — improve product development and resiliencetrackonomy.ai. Par 2025, autour 74 % of logistics data will be standardised, permettant une intégration transparente dans les chaînes d’approvisionnementtrackonomy.ai.

Explication élargie

Different regions face unique challenges. In the Middle East, extreme temperatures and complex supply routes require remote control features to adjust storage conditions instantlymaersk.com. The Gulf’s push for solar‑powered cooling units and compostable packaging shows how policy goals (Saudi Vision 2030 and UAE Net Zero 2050) shape logistics investmentsmaersk.com. Dans Amérique du Nord, consumers expect fast delivery of fresh produce, leading to investment in last‑mile distribution hubs and partnerships between meal‑kit companies and cold storage providersarcadiacold.com. Asia‑Pacific is rapidly expanding cold storage capacity and adopting advanced packaging technologies, driven by population growth and rising incomesnatlawreview.com. Strategic alliances and data standardisation help partners share visibility, align schedules and recover quickly from disruptionstrackonomy.ai.

Questions fréquemment posées

Q1: What are the biggest cold chain logistics updates in 2025?
Automation, Capteurs IoT, AI‑powered analytics and blockchain traceability are the major updates. These technologies improve efficiency, reduce waste and ensure compliance with stricter regulations.

Q2: How is the cold chain logistics market expected to grow after 2025?
The global market is predicted to increase from USD 436.3 milliard dans 2025 to about USD 1.36 trillion par 2034 avec un 13.46 % TCACprecedenceresearch.com, driven by demand for perishable foods and biopharmaceuticals.

Q3: Why is sustainability important in cold chain logistics?
Cold chain operations consume energy and emit roughly 2 % of global CO₂. Sustainable practices like solar‑powered storage, eco‑friendly packaging and energy‑efficient refrigeration reduce emissions and cut costs.

Q4: What role does AI play in cold chain logistics?
AI forecasts demand, optimises routes, predicts equipment failures and monitors temperature data. Par exemple, AI helps Middle‑Eastern dairy distributors forecast Ramadan demand spikes and automatically reroutes deliveries during traffic or weather disruptionspharmanow.live.

Q5: How can small businesses adapt to cold chain updates?
Start with affordable IoT sensors and basic automation. Partner with third‑party cold chain providers that use blockchain and AI, and choose reusable packaging solutions to reduce waste. Gradually scale investments as you see cost savings and improved reliability.
